什么是数据库 SQL Execution Plan

什么是数据库 SQL Execution Plan

SQL Execution Plan(SQL 执行计划)是数据库管理系统在执行 SQL 语句时,对如何高效检索数据进行的一系列优化步骤的描述。当我们向数据库提交一个查询(比如 SELECT 语句)时,数据库的查询优化器会对该查询进行分析,生成多个可能的执行方案,并根据成本模型选择成本最低(即最快)的...

每日一博 - 闲聊SQL Query Execution Order

每日一博 - 闲聊SQL Query Execution Order

SQL查询阶段在MySQL中,SQL查询的执行顺序可以分为以下几个阶段:    词法分析(Lexical Analysis):在这个阶段,MySQL首先将SQL查询文本分解成词法单元,例如关键字、标识符、操作符等等。这个过程会删除注释并将查询文本拆分成可识别的单词。  ...

如何在 PolarDB-X 中优化慢 SQL

2 课时 |
113 人已学 |
免费

SQL完全自学手册

61 课时 |
3601 人已学 |
免费

SQL Server on Linux入门教程

14 课时 |
4329 人已学 |
免费
开发者课程背景图
【MybatisPlus异常】The SQL execution time is too large, please optimize

【MybatisPlus异常】The SQL execution time is too large, please optimize

一、项目背景Spring boot (v2.0.0.RELEASE) + mybatis-plus (3.1.1)二、报错信息在使用MybatisPlus的过程中,记录一下踩过的坑,以下是报错的内容:### Cause: com.baomidou.mybatisplus.core.exception...

[帮助文档] 通过DMS登录云数据库RDSSQLServer实例时报\"Logonfailedforlogin'user'duetotriggerexecution\"的错误如何解决_数据管理(DMS)

问题描述通过数据管理DMS登录云数据库RDS SQL Server实例时,提示以下错误。Logon failed for login 'user' due to trigger execution问题原因可能是以下原因所导致:RDS SQL Server实例的连接数已满。进程数量存在阻塞的情况。解决...

问题整理:ZABBIX4.0登录界面出现错误 SQL statement execution has failed “INSERT INTO sessions (sessionid,userid,..

问题整理:ZABBIX4.0登录界面出现错误 SQL statement execution has failed “INSERT INTO sessions (sessionid,userid,..

登录zabbix4.0界面,出现报错:​SQL statement execution has failed "​​INSERT​​ INTO sessions (sessionid,userid,lastaccess,status) VALUES ('6d1a0523bd8cd53179fcdfc...

[帮助文档] 连接RDSSQLServer数据库时出现'Logonfailedforlogin'user'duetotriggerexecution'报错如何解决_云数据库 RDS(RDS)

问题描述用户在使用DMS控制台,连接RDS SQL Server数据库时出现Logon failed for login ‘user’ due to trigger execution报错。Logon failed for login ‘user’ due to trigger execution问...

[帮助文档] 在RDS MySQL和PolarDB MySQL中执行SQL查询语句时提示“Query execution was interrupted, max_statement_time exceeded”错误[KB:427058]

问题描述在阿里云云数据库RDS MySQL和云原生关系型数据库PolarDB MySQL中执行SQL查询语句时,提示以下错误:Query execution was interrupted, max_statement_time exceeded问题原因SQL查询时间超过以下参数的值,查询将会自动失...

[帮助文档] Dataphin管道任务报错java.sql.SQLException: [40040, 2022032716265317201800101403151301854] Query execution error: : Query exceeded reserved memory limit[KB:423827]

问题描述管道任务报错java.sql.SQLException: [40040, 2022032716265317201800101403151301854] Query execution error: : Query exceeded reserved memory limit。问题原因当前Qu...

SAP ABAP SQL的execution plan和cache

SAP ABAP SQL的execution plan和cache

我在SE38里执行这段open SQL:因为我在OPEN SQL里没有使用IGNORE_PLAN_CACHE这个hint,所以execution plan会存储在表M_SQL_PLAN_CACHE里。这个表的PREPARATION_TIME field就包含了statement的preparatio...

Can you explain the PL/SQL execution architecture?

Can you explain the PL/SQL execution architecture?

本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。

产品推荐

社区圈子

数据库
数据库
分享数据库前沿,解构实战干货,推动数据库技术变革
253177+人已加入
加入
相关电子书
更多
PolarDB NL2SQL: 帮助您写出准确、优化的SQL
基于 Flink SQL + Paimon 构建流式湖仓新方
SQL智能诊断优化产品SQLess蚂蚁最佳实践
立即下载 立即下载 立即下载